World News Dead newborn found in Ohio college dorm bathroom by James Ma October 20, 2019 by James Ma October 20, 2019 Ohio police are investigating after the body of a newborn was found inside a… 0 FacebookTwitterPinterestLinkedinWhatsappTelegramEmail
World News Ohio mom, 20, acquitted of killing newborn by James Ma September 12, 2019 by James Ma September 12, 2019 A young Ohio mother was acquitted Thursday of charges that she killed her unwanted… 0 FacebookTwitterPinterestLinkedinWhatsappTelegramEmail